The Hundred: Joe Root, Adil Rashid among players in UK’s first ever player auction at Piccadilly Lights | Cricket News

The Hundred’s player auction is set to take place at Piccadilly Lights on Wednesday 11 and Thursday March 12.

The UK’s first-ever player auction will feature 16 Hundred franchises picking up to 14 players for their men’s and women’s teams, with over 200 eligible players for teams to bid on.

The women’s auction will open proceedings on March 11, with Beth Mooney, Nadine de Klerk and Amy Jones among others available, while Joe Root, Adil Rashid, and Jason Holder headline the men’s auction, taking place a day later.

Each men’s team has a salary cap of £2.05m in total – compared with £880,000 for the women’s squad – minus the amount spent on direct signings already.

Players are divided into three tiers – Hero, Ranked and Nominated – based on the amount of aggregated pre-registered interest from each team. The Hero players will be bid on in the first phase of the auction, followed by the ranked and nominated players in the next two phases.

Every match from the men’s and women’s competitions will be live on Sky Sports, including the eliminators on Friday August 14 and finals on Sunday August 16, with every day seeing a women’s game precede a men’s fixture at the same venue.

Which players have already been signed for the 2026 Hundred season?

Jacob Bethell (Birmingham Phoenix), Jos Buttler (Manchester Super Giants) and Nat Sciver-Brunt (Trent Rockets) were among the big names retained, while Mitchell Marsh (Sunrisers Leeds), Alice Capsey (Birmingham Phoenix) and Smriti Mandhana (Manchester Super Giants) are three of the new signings.

Manchester Super Giants Women, MI London Women, Sunrisers Leeds Women and Welsh Fire Women only signed three players, so will have more money to play with at the auction, with £310,000 deducted from their overall salary pot of £880,000.

The other four women’s sides – Birmingham Phoenix, London Spirit, Southern Brave and Trent Rockets – have had £360,000 deducted after making four signings or retentions.

Each of the men’s teams have had £950,000 removed from their overall salary pot of £2.05m after making all four permitted signings during the pre-auction window.

Hundred franchises are now allowed to sign four overseas players, up from the previous three.
